Guest10181154 I had rabbits devouring one of my potted hibiscus plants. At first I thought someone was cutting it because the missing stems looked to have been snipped with such precision. Not to mention the “cut” twigs were no where to be seen. It wasn’t until nearly the entire plant was gnawed off that I realized it was rabbits. They were apparently getting into the pot, gnawing the stem, and dragging the stem and flower under my back deck to eat.
